Beschreibung

SNNYATHYAESVK-(Lys-13C6,15N2) (TFA) is the peptide containing 13C- and 15N-labeled Lys.

Application

1. This compound can be used as a tracer.
2. This compound can be used as an internal standard for quantitative analysis by NMR, GC-MS, or LC-MS.

In Vitro

Stable heavy isotopes of hydrogen, carbon, and other elements have been incorporated into drug molecules, largely as tracers for quantitation during the drug development process. Deuteration has gained attention because of its potential to affect the pharmacokinetic and metabolic profiles of drugs[1].

Molekulargewicht

1491.48 (free acid)

Formel

C5813C6H94N1615N2O23.xC2HF3O2

Sequence

Ser-Asn-Asn-Tyr-Ala-Thr-His-Tyr-Ala-Glu-Ser-Val-{Lys(13C6,15N2)} (TFA salt)

Sequence Shortening

SNNYATHYAESVK-{Lys(13C6,15N2)} (TFA salt)
